diff options
author | Andy Lutomirski <luto@mit.edu> | 2011-04-18 15:31:32 -0400 |
---|---|---|
committer | Andy Lutomirski <luto@mit.edu> | 2011-04-18 15:31:32 -0400 |
commit | d3253157d594a0def7a07cc07db689cf2043e61c (patch) | |
tree | e5cddf2aa9a28b174a60689ea66e73409562072b | |
parent | dec6081b164807bdf85636ee148d7ad7db28625b (diff) | |
download | misc-tests-d3253157d594a0def7a07cc07db689cf2043e61c.tar.gz |
Reorder load3 to make sense.
-rw-r--r-- | evil-clock-test.cc |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/evil-clock-test.cc b/evil-clock-test.cc index 5d8f4b3..dd2ce03 100644 --- a/evil-clock-test.cc +++ b/evil-clock-test.cc @@ -502,9 +502,9 @@ class Load3Test : public SequenceTest public: void Start() { - StartThread((ThreadProc)&Load3Test::WriterThread); StartThread((ThreadProc)&Load3Test::LoadBeforeClock); StartThread((ThreadProc)&Load3Test::LoadAfterClock); + StartThread((ThreadProc)&Load3Test::WriterThread); } private: @@ -524,7 +524,7 @@ private: SendStartSignal(); /* Run until finished */ - while(!end && (!thread_done(1) || !thread_done(2))) + while(!end && (!thread_done(0) || !thread_done(1))) { ACCESS_ONCE(seq) = ++my_seq; } |